Aji Amarillo is the backbone of Peruvian cuisine. Bright, fruity, and moderately hot at 30,000-50,000 SHU, this yellow chilli paste is irreplaceable in authentic Latin American cooking - and increasingly sought after by UK chefs pushing beyond European flavour profiles.
What it is: A smooth, ready-to-use paste made from whole aji amarillo peppers grown in Peru. Vibrant orange-yellow in colour, with a distinctly fruity, mango-like heat that sets it apart from any European chilli paste.

How UK chefs are using Chatica Aji Amarillo Paste:
- Ceviche and tiradito - the defining flavour of Peruvian seafood dishes; a spoonful adds fruity heat and a beautiful golden colour to the leche de tigre marinade
- Aji de Gallina - the classic creamy Peruvian chicken stew that is appearing on London menus from Fitzrovia to Shoreditch
- Papas a la Huancaina - spiced cheese sauce over potatoes, a standout sharing plate or side dish
- Marinades and glazes - blended with oil and garlic for chicken, lamb, and seafood before roasting or grilling
- Sauces and dressings - stirred into mayonnaise, sour cream, or vinaigrettes for a vibrant, spiced condiment
- Empanadas and street food fillings - adds depth and heat to meat and vegetable fillings

Dulce de Leche - literally "milk candy" in Spanish - is one of the most versatile ingredients in the Latin American pantry, and one of the most in-demand by UK pastry chefs and dessert specialists right now.
Made by slowly heating sweetened milk until the Maillard reaction transforms it into a deep, golden caramel with a perfectly smooth, spreadable texture, Chatica Dulce de Leche brings genuine Colombian provenance to your dessert menu.
What it is: A rich, creamy caramel spread with a deep, indulgent flavour. Thicker and more complex than standard caramel sauce, with a slow-cooked depth that customers notice immediately.

Yuca - also known as cassava - is one of the most versatile and underutilised ingredients in the UK catering sector. Naturally gluten-free, starchy, and with a mild, slightly nutty flavour once cooked, it is the Latin American answer to the potato - and it is finding its way onto menus across the UK as chefs respond to growing demand for gluten-free and allergen-conscious alternatives.
What it is: A starchy tropical root vegetable, native to South America and widely used across Colombian and Peruvian cuisine. Once cooked, yuca becomes soft and fluffy with a denser, more satisfying texture than potato - making it ideal for frying, boiling, mashing, and baking.

How UK restaurants and caterers are using Chatica Yuca:
- Yuca fries - a growing alternative to standard chips on restaurant menus; crispier on the outside, fluffier inside, and naturally gluten-free. Increasingly popular in Latin American, Caribbean, and fusion restaurants across London
- Boiled yuca with mojo sauce - a traditional Colombian side dish that pairs with grilled meats and fish; simple to prepare in bulk for catering operations
- Yuca mash - a denser, more flavourful alternative to mashed potato; works as a base for stews, braises, and slow-cooked meats
- Cassava starch for baking - Chatica Almidon de Yuca (cassava starch) is used by gluten-free bakeries across the UK for bread, pastry, and flatbreads; a reliable, high-quality starch with consistent performance
